FAQs About the word amaretto

Amaretto

an Italian almond liqueur

No synonyms found.

No antonyms found.

amarelle => Guinda, amarantus => Amaranto, amaranthus spinosus => Amaranto espinoso, amaranthus hypochondriacus => Amaranto, amaranthus hybridus hypochondriacus => amaranthus hybridus hypochondriacus,